Are people in Plainfield older or younger than people in Plano?
- The Median Age in Plainfield is 5.8 years older than in Plano.

Are housing costs cheaper in Plainfield or Plano?
- Plainfield housing costs are 37.6% more expensive than Plano hous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Plainfield or Plano?
- The average commute for residents of Plainfield is 7.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Plano.

Things to do in Plano?
Plano, IL is a small rural town located in the heart of northern Illinois. Just an hour outside Chicago, Plano offers the perfect mix of tranquility and convenience. With its picturesque streets lined with charming homes and independent businesses, Plano is a great place to explore. From outdoor activities such as fishing, hiking and biking to more relaxed pastimes like antiquing and enjoying local restaurants, visitors will find plenty of options for entertainment.
